Don’t tell Sid! Government’s Natwest sale could be ‘dangerous’, says FTSE 250 chief
The government’s plan to offload its remaining stake in Natwest could be “dangerous” and lead to a flood of retail investors ramping up their exposure to a single stock, the chief of a FTSE 250 wealth manager has warned.

Conservatives’ by-election scorecard since 2019 general election
Defeat in Blackpool South means the Conservatives have now lost 11 by-elections since the 2019 general election.
